1. Advanced Engineering and Technology

Engineering remains a cornerstone of institutional excellence. Programs spanning mechanical, electrical, and chemical engineering focus heavily on sustainable technologies, green energy solutions, and automated systems. These popular courses are designed to meet the growing demand for engineers who can tackle climate change and infrastructure modernization.

2. Computer Science and Data Analytics

With artificial intelligence, machine learning, and cybersecurity driving the global economy, computing degrees are more vital than ever. Students enrolled in these pathways gain hands-on coding experience, algorithmic problem-solving skills, and deep insights into data structures. Graduate jobs in this sector boast some of the highest starting salaries in the UK.

3. Biotechnology and Life Sciences

The intersection of biology and modern technology opens doors to pharmaceuticals, genetic research, and healthcare innovations. The curriculum emphasizes laboratory techniques, bioethics, and commercial drug development, preparing students for impactful careers in research and clinical development.

Maximizing Your Time at University

Securing a top-tier job after graduation is not just about attending lectures. To truly stand out, freshers must engage in extracurricular activities, hackathons, societies, and networking events. Building a portfolio of personal projects or contributing to open-source research can also set you apart from thousands of other applicants.
